diff options
author | 2011-08-28 15:47:25 +0000 | |
---|---|---|
committer | 2011-08-28 15:47:25 +0000 | |
commit | a447ee29d30ec4f4c537ccb16ec2093feedae67d (patch) | |
tree | 683dc7c904253979d2f5cce6617ba6544121cce1 /app-text/xdvik | |
parent | Remove useless blocker. (diff) | |
download | gentoo-2-a447ee29d30ec4f4c537ccb16ec2093feedae67d.tar.gz gentoo-2-a447ee29d30ec4f4c537ccb16ec2093feedae67d.tar.bz2 gentoo-2-a447ee29d30ec4f4c537ccb16ec2093feedae67d.zip |
Move the previous change to -r0
(Portage version: 2.2.0_alpha51/cvs/Linux x86_64)
Diffstat (limited to 'app-text/xdvik')
-rw-r--r-- | app-text/xdvik/ChangeLog | 6 | ||||
-rw-r--r-- | app-text/xdvik/xdvik-22.84.16-r1.ebuild | 100 | ||||
-rw-r--r-- | app-text/xdvik/xdvik-22.84.16.ebuild | 8 |
3 files changed, 10 insertions, 104 deletions
diff --git a/app-text/xdvik/ChangeLog b/app-text/xdvik/ChangeLog index ea6faab575a8..6db9b1d2baac 100644 --- a/app-text/xdvik/ChangeLog +++ b/app-text/xdvik/ChangeLog @@ -1,6 +1,10 @@ # ChangeLog for app-text/xdvik # Copyright 1999-2011 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/app-text/xdvik/ChangeLog,v 1.78 2011/08/25 22:29:45 naota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-text/xdvik/ChangeLog,v 1.79 2011/08/28 15:47:25 naota Exp $ + + 28 Aug 2011; Naohiro Aota <naota@gentoo.org> xdvik-22.84.16.ebuild, + -xdvik-22.84.16-r1.ebuild: + Move the previous change to -r0 *xdvik-22.84.16-r1 (25 Aug 2011) diff --git a/app-text/xdvik/xdvik-22.84.16-r1.ebuild b/app-text/xdvik/xdvik-22.84.16-r1.ebuild deleted file mode 100644 index 0aeeb7cd8e41..000000000000 --- a/app-text/xdvik/xdvik-22.84.16-r1.ebuild +++ /dev/null @@ -1,100 +0,0 @@ -# Copyright 1999-2011 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-text/xdvik/xdvik-22.84.16-r1.ebuild,v 1.1 2011/08/25 22:29:45 naota Exp $ - -EAPI=3 -inherit eutils flag-o-matic elisp-common toolchain-funcs - -DESCRIPTION="DVI previewer for X Window System" -HOMEPAGE="http://xdvi.sourceforge.net/" -SRC_URI="mirror://sourceforge/xdvi/${P}.tar.gz" - -K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~ppc ~ppc64 ~sh ~sparc ~x86 ~x86-fbsd ~x86-freebsd 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~sparc-solaris ~x64-solaris ~x86-solaris" -SLOT="0" -LICENSE="GPL-2" -IUSE="motif neXt Xaw3d emacs" - -RDEPEND=">=media-libs/t1lib-5.0.2 - x11-libs/libXmu - x11-libs/libXp - x11-libs/libXpm - motif? ( >=x11-libs/openmotif-2.3:0 ) - !motif? ( neXt? ( x11-libs/neXtaw ) - !neXt? ( Xaw3d? ( x11-libs/libXaw3d ) ) ) - virtual/latex-base - !<app-text/texlive-2007" -DEPEND="sys-devel/flex - virtual/yacc - ${RDEPEND}" -TEXMF_PATH=/usr/share/texmf -S=${WORKDIR}/${P}/texk/xdvik - -src_prepare() { - epatch "${FILESDIR}"/${P}-open-mode.patch \ - "${FILESDIR}"/${P}-cvararg.patch \ - "${FILESDIR}"/${P}-parallel_make.patch - has_version '>=app-text/texlive-core-2009' && epatch "${FILESDIR}"/${P}-kpathsea_version.patch - # Make sure system kpathsea headers are used - cd "${WORKDIR}/${P}/texk/kpathsea" - for i in *.h ; do echo "#include_next \"$i\"" > $i; done -} - -src_configure() { - cd "${WORKDIR}/${P}" - - tc-export CC AR RANLIB - - local toolkit - - if use motif ; then - toolkit="motif" - elif use neXt ; then - toolkit="neXtaw" - elif use Xaw3d ; then - toolkit="xaw3d" - else - toolkit="xaw" - fi - - econf --disable-multiplatform \ - --enable-t1lib \ - --enable-gf \ - --with-system-t1lib \ - --with-system-kpathsea \ - --with-kpathsea-include="${EPREFIX}"/usr/include/kpathsea \ - --with-xdvi-x-toolkit="${toolkit}" -} - -src_compile() { - emake kpathsea_dir="${EPREFIX}/usr/include/kpathsea" texmf="${EPREFIX}${TEXMF_PATH}" || die - use emacs && elisp-compile xdvi-search.el -} - -src_install() { - einstall kpathsea_dir="${EPREFIX}/usr/include/kpathsea" texmf="${ED}${TEXMF_PATH}" || die "install failed" - - dodir /etc/texmf/xdvi /etc/X11/app-defaults - mv "${ED}${TEXMF_PATH}/xdvi/XDvi" "${ED}etc/X11/app-defaults" || die "failed to move config file" - dosym {/etc/X11/app-defaults,"${TEXMF_PATH}/xdvi"}/XDvi || die "failed to symlink config file" - for i in $(find "${ED}${TEXMF_PATH}/xdvi" -maxdepth 1 -type f) ; do - mv ${i} "${ED}etc/texmf/xdvi" || die "failed to move $i" - dosym {/etc/texmf,"${TEXMF_PATH}"}/xdvi/$(basename ${i}) || die "failed to symlink $i" - done - - dodoc BUGS FAQ README.* || die "dodoc failed" - - use emacs && elisp-install tex-utils *.el *.elc - - doicon "${FILESDIR}"/${PN}.xpm - make_desktop_entry xdvi "XDVI" xdvik "Graphics;Viewer" - echo "MimeType=application/x-dvi;" >> "${ED}"usr/share/applications/xdvi-"${PN}".desktop -} - -pkg_postinst() { - if use emacs; then - elog "Add" - elog " (add-to-list 'load-path \"${EPREFIX}${SITELISP}/tex-utils\")" - elog " (require 'xdvi-search)" - elog "to your ~/.emacs file" - fi -} diff --git a/app-text/xdvik/xdvik-22.84.16.ebuild b/app-text/xdvik/xdvik-22.84.16.ebuild index 8603b4874633..f0cfc3fd82f3 100644 --- a/app-text/xdvik/xdvik-22.84.16.ebuild +++ b/app-text/xdvik/xdvik-22.84.16.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2011 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/app-text/xdvik/xdvik-22.84.16.ebuild,v 1.14 2011/08/02 05:45:55 mattst88 Exp $ +# $Header: /var/cvsroot/gentoo-x86/app-text/xdvik/xdvik-22.84.16.ebuild,v 1.15 2011/08/28 15:47:25 naota Exp $ EAPI=3 inherit eutils flag-o-matic elisp-common toolchain-funcs @@ -9,7 +9,7 @@ DESCRIPTION="DVI previewer for X Window System" HOMEPAGE="http://xdvi.sourceforge.net/" SRC_URI="mirror://sourceforge/xdvi/${P}.tar.gz" -KEYWORDS="alpha amd64 arm hppa ia64 ppc ppc64 sh sparc x86 ~x86-fbsd ~x86-freebsd 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~sparc-solaris ~x64-solaris ~x86-solaris" +K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~ppc ~ppc64 ~sh ~sparc ~x86 ~x86-fbsd ~x86-freebsd ~amd64-linux ~x86-linux ~ppc-macos ~x64-macos ~sparc-solaris ~x64-solaris ~x86-solaris" SLOT="0" LICENSE="GPL-2" IUSE="motif neXt Xaw3d emacs" @@ -23,7 +23,9 @@ RDEPEND=">=media-libs/t1lib-5.0.2 !neXt? ( Xaw3d? ( x11-libs/libXaw3d ) ) ) virtual/latex-base !<app-text/texlive-2007" -DEPEND="${RDEPEND}" +DEPEND="sys-devel/flex + virtual/yacc + ${RDEPEND}" TEXMF_PATH=/usr/share/texmf S=${WORKDIR}/${P}/texk/xdvik |